Reading defender Michael Morrison says Leeds United will have to deal with the Royals strengths on Tuesday evening as Mark Bowen's side aim to get back to winning ways.

Marcelo Bielsa's Whites make the trip to Berkshire for the Championship clash in strong form having it made it six games unbeaten with Saturday's late 2-1 victory over Luton Town.

Reading themselves fell to a first defeat under Bowen at Brentford after he took charge of the club in mid-October.

Morrison, though, believes his side can test the Championship second-placed side.

"This whole week will show how far this team has come," Morrison said.

"Brentford, Leeds then Wigan to finish up, so it’ll be a good barometer of where we are and what we’re pushing for.

"If we can get a win at home, it sets it up to still be a good week. It’s an important game and we want to get back to winning ways. We certainly don’t want back-to-back defeats.

"It is important we get back on the horse and get some points to keep us ticking over. We will be aiming for the three points, but it's important to keep getting points.

"You look at our home form recently, three wins in a row. We are looking positive and we think it’s a game we can go and win.

"We have strengths that they’ll have to deal with - it will be a good game of football and we’ll be itching to get back and win the game.

"Leeds always bring good support. It will be nice to play under the lights and we will be giving everything."
